175.10 FRAUD IN SELECTION OF JURORS.
   If any person shall be guilty of any fraud, by tampering with the jury box prior to drawing jurors, or in drawing a juror, or in returning into the jury box the name of any person which has lawfully been drawn out and drawing and substituting another instead, or in failing to place such name in the box for the ballots marked "drawn", or in any other way in the drawing of jurors, he shall, on conviction thereof, be punished by a fine not exceeding five hundred dollars ($500.00).
